THE STORY
Madison offers a new point of view for how we understand interior design. It aims to take centre stage in the space, as a powerful architectural element where the space created speaks of those that live there. It offers harmonious combinations of colours and textures, where stone is reinterpreted in order to form part of the décor. Madison is presented in 4 colours in order to provide your projects with the versatility of cool and warm tones without sacrificing the character of its image.
MATERIAL
Glazed Porcelain Tile
APPLICATION
Floor
Wall
COUNTRY OF ORIGIN
Spain
VARIATION
Shade and Veins Variation (V3)
AVAILABLE DIMENSIONS
(L)595 × (W)295 mm
FINISH
Matt
